Shiv Shakti 20th February 2024 Written Episode Update

The episode commences with Devraj Indra arriving in Asur lok, where he teases Diti for finding a beautiful wife for Rambh, causing laughter. Chandradev predicts that the universe will ridicule Rambh and the Asurs. Rambh, however, warns the Devas against mocking his wife, vowing to love Shyamala in all her forms and stating that his affection for her will remain constant. Devraj Indra mocks Rambh’s love, which angers Shiv.

Rambh declares his love for Shyamala’s soul, indifferent to others’ opinions. Shumbh advises Rambh to depart Asur lok with Shyamala, a suggestion Ragu believes is in the Asurs’ best interest. Shukracharya, however, disagrees, reminding them that their enemies are the Devas, not Rambh.

Devraj Indra expresses his sorrow over the Asurs’ foolishness and tells Shukracharya that everyone will ridicule the Asurs because of Rambh. Chandradev and the Asurs urge Shukracharya to expel Rambh and Shyamala from Asur lok. Rambh protests, but Shukracharya encourages him not to concede defeat.

Rambh refuses to tolerate any disrespect towards his wife and informs Shukracharya of his decision to leave Asur lok with his wife. Despite Diti’s pleas for him to stay, Rambh insists on leaving, citing Shyamala’s devotion to Shiv and Shiv’s tandav dance in honor of his wife’s respect. He departs with Shyamala, leaving Diti to reprimand everyone for their actions. Devraj Indra reminds Diti that they are not relatives but perpetual adversaries, adding that all is fair in love and war.

In Kailash, Shiv declares that disrespecting someone’s love is a sin and that Devraj Indra will be punished for this transgression. He then departs, leaving Narad to plead with Parvati to restrain Shiv, fearing his anger. Parvati reassures him that Shiv, being Mahadev, will not act without reason and expresses her support for Shiv, adding that he will punish those who disrespect love.

Rambh reassures Shyamala of his enduring love for her and predicts that Brahmadev’s boon will come true and their son will avenge their insult. Devraj Indra and the other Devas arrive, and Devraj Indra tells Rambh that their conversation in Asur lok was not finished. He expresses a desire to hear Rambh’s love story. Rambh retorts that Devraj Indra is a good talker but a coward on the battlefield. Shiv then appears in the form of an old man.

Narad confesses to Narayan his confusion over Shiv’s leela. Parvati transforms into an old woman and is greeted by Nandi before departing. Narad asks Narayan to explain Shiv and Parvati’s leela, to which Narayan responds that this leela is about love.

Shiv admonishes the Devas for their wrongdoing. Devraj Indra insists that he always does the right thing, but Shiv counters that he should protect lovers. Devraj Indra tells Shiv to do his job and leave, but Shiv insists that the topic at hand is love. He professes his deep love for his wife and his understanding of love. Parvati then arrives in the form of an old woman (the title song plays in the background).

Shiv instructs the Devas to fulfill their responsibilities and not harm Rambh and Shyamala. He warns them to be prepared for punishment if they do wrong. Devraj Indra tells Suryadev that he can’t stand the sight of the old man. Suryadev throws Shiv’s fruit bowl and tells him to leave. The Devas laugh, and Shiv challenges them to a fight.

In the preview, Devraj Indra tells Shiv that he will die. Parvati appears in the form of an old woman.
